    Pageants cost money, what they don't tell you is that if you win you will need several new wardrobe items, that you will be doing fundraisers and the financial output will continue. Even giving up your title you will want to do something for the contestants in your age range...a small gift that adds up when there are many contestants.

    If you are serious about the pageant, I agree a coach will really help. My girls (3 daughters participated) did small local pageants. Yes, they won, but it didn't really feel like a victory with so few competing. During each pageant we would all learned something new. Eventually we learned enough for one daughter to get the state title twice ( different age groups). We did eventually get a coach after a really bad experience at a pageant group we hadn't worked with before. They literally destroyed my daughter's self image. They did so many things that were inappropriate to do and say to a contestant. She lost her confidence. The coach worked with her twice. She won her next title. She went back and was coached one time for the state title. She won. But honestly if the girls had gone to a coach for the first one they would have started from a much stronger place.
